十年網(wǎng)站開發(fā)經(jīng)驗 + 多家企業(yè)客戶 + 靠譜的建站團隊
量身定制 + 運營維護+專業(yè)推廣+無憂售后,網(wǎng)站問題一站解決
Java是一種廣泛用于開發(fā)軟件和應(yīng)用程序的編程語言,它是一種跨平臺的語言,可以在各種操作系統(tǒng)上運行。在Linux系統(tǒng)中安裝和使用Java是很常見的,但如何查看Linux系統(tǒng)中安裝的Java版本卻是一個廣受關(guān)注的問題。

創(chuàng)新互聯(lián)公司長期為近1000家客戶提供的網(wǎng)站建設(shè)服務(wù),團隊從業(yè)經(jīng)驗10年,關(guān)注不同地域、不同群體,并針對不同對象提供差異化的產(chǎn)品和服務(wù);打造開放共贏平臺,與合作伙伴共同營造健康的互聯(lián)網(wǎng)生態(tài)環(huán)境。為井陘礦企業(yè)提供專業(yè)的網(wǎng)站設(shè)計、做網(wǎng)站,井陘礦網(wǎng)站改版等技術(shù)服務(wù)。擁有10多年豐富建站經(jīng)驗和眾多成功案例,為您定制開發(fā)。
本文將介紹如何在Linux系統(tǒng)中查看Java版本。無論是在命令行中查看還是在GUI環(huán)境中查看,Linux系統(tǒng)都有多種方法可供選擇。
1. 命令行方式查看Java版本
在Linux系統(tǒng)中使用命令行是常見的操作方式之一,也是查看Java版本的常見方式之一。下面是在命令行中查看Java版本的幾種方式。
1.1 使用java命令查看Java版本
Java的安裝包中自帶了一個java命令,可以通過這個命令查看Java版本。下面是java命令的使用方式:
“`shell
java -version
“`
在命令行中輸入上述命令,即可查看系統(tǒng)中當前使用的Java版本。
如果系統(tǒng)中沒有安裝Java,則會提示未找到Java的安裝路徑。
1.2 使用which命令查看Java路徑
另一種查看Java版本的方法是使用which命令來查看Java的安裝路徑。這個方法可以在系統(tǒng)中查找Java的安裝路徑,同時也可以驗證是否已經(jīng)安裝了Java。
“`shell
which java
“`
使用上述命令能夠在命令行中獲得Java的安裝路徑,這個路徑包括了Java的版本信息。
1.3 使用echo命令查看Java_HOME變量
Java_HOME是一個重要的環(huán)境變量,它指向Java的安裝路徑。在Linux中,Java_HOME變量的默認值為/usr/lib/jvm/java,但是這個值在不同的Linux系統(tǒng)版本和Java安裝版本中可能會發(fā)生變化,我們需要通過echo命令來查看Java_HOME變量的值。
“`shell
echo $JAVA_HOME
“`
使用上述命令可以在命令行中查看Java_HOME變量的值,從而了解Java的安裝路徑和版本信息。
2. GUI方式查看Java版本
在Linux圖形界面的環(huán)境中,也有多種方法可以查看Java版本,下面是其中幾種方式。
2.1 使用運行框查看Java版本
在Linux的桌面環(huán)境中,運行框是一個很方便的工具,我們可以通過運行框來啟動Java應(yīng)用程序,也可以通過運行框來查看Java版本信息。
在運行框中輸入以下命令:
“`shell
java -version
“`
這會打開一個終端窗口顯示當前使用的Java版本信息。
2.2 使用系統(tǒng)監(jiān)視器查看Java版本
系統(tǒng)監(jiān)視器是Linux桌面環(huán)境中一個非常常見的應(yīng)用程序,我們可以使用它來查看當前系統(tǒng)中正在運行的進程和應(yīng)用程序,以及它們所使用的系統(tǒng)資源。
在Linux的桌面環(huán)境中,一般都會自帶有一個系統(tǒng)監(jiān)視器,我們可以打開系統(tǒng)監(jiān)視器來查看當前系統(tǒng)中Java應(yīng)用程序的版本信息。
在系統(tǒng)監(jiān)視器中,選中正在運行的Java應(yīng)用程序,然后從應(yīng)用程序?qū)傩灾胁榭碕ava版本信息。
:
在本文中,我們介紹了如何在Linux系統(tǒng)中查看Java版本。無論是在命令行中查看,還是在GUI環(huán)境中查看,都有多種方法可供選擇。如果您是開發(fā)人員,那么了解如何查看Java版本是非常重要的,因為它會直接影響您開發(fā)的應(yīng)用程序的兼容性和性能。通過本文介紹的方法,您可以更快地找到您所需要的Java版本,并且更好地管理您的Java應(yīng)用程序。
相關(guān)問題拓展閱讀:
System.out.println(“===========os.name:”+System.getProperties().getProperty(“os.name”));
System.out.println(“===========file.separator:”+System.getProperties().getProperty(“file.separator”));
System類
public static Properties getProperties()
將 getProperty(String) 方法使用的當前系統(tǒng)屬性作毀襲為 Properties 對象返回
鍵 相關(guān)值的描述
java.version Java 運行時環(huán)境版本
java.vendor Java 運行時環(huán)境供應(yīng)商
java.vendor.url Java 供應(yīng)商的 URL
java.home Java 安裝目錄
java.vm.specification.version Java 虛擬機規(guī)范版本
java.vm.specification.vendor Java 虛擬機規(guī)范供應(yīng)商
java.vm.specification.name Java 虛擬機規(guī)范名稱
java.vm.version Java 虛擬機實行帶現(xiàn)版本
java.vm.vendor Java 虛擬機實現(xiàn)供應(yīng)商
java.vm.name Java 虛擬機實現(xiàn)名稱
java.specification.version Java 運行時環(huán)境規(guī)范版本
java.specification.vendor Java 運行時環(huán)境規(guī)范供應(yīng)商
java.specification.name Java 運行時環(huán)境規(guī)范名稱
java.class.version Java 類格式版本號
java.class.path Java 類路徑
java.library.path 加載庫時搜索的路徑列表
java.io.tmpdir 默認的臨時文件路徑
javpiler 要使用的 JIT 編譯器的名稱
java.ext.dirs 一個或多個擴展目錄的路徑
os.name 操作系統(tǒng)的名稱
os.arch 操作系統(tǒng)的架構(gòu)
os.version 操作系統(tǒng)的版本
file.separator 文件分隔符(在 UNIX 系統(tǒng)中是“/”)
path.separator 路徑分隔符(在 UNIX 系統(tǒng)中是“:”)
line.separator 行分隔符(在 UNIX 系統(tǒng)中是“/檔余蘆n”)
user.name 用戶的賬戶名稱
user.home 用戶的主目錄
user.dir 用戶的當前工作目錄
public class Demo
{
public static void main ( String args )
{
System.out.println (System.getProperty (“歲枝os.name”));
}
}
希饑迅望可以乎肢敏幫到你
查看java版本 linux系統(tǒng)的介紹就聊到這里吧,感謝你花時間閱讀本站內(nèi)容,更多關(guān)于查看java版本 linux系統(tǒng),如何在Linux系統(tǒng)中查看Java版本?,java 如何判斷操作系統(tǒng)是Linux還是Windows的信息別忘了在本站進行查找喔。
香港服務(wù)器選創(chuàng)新互聯(lián),2H2G首月10元開通。
創(chuàng)新互聯(lián)(www.cdcxhl.com)互聯(lián)網(wǎng)服務(wù)提供商,擁有超過10年的服務(wù)器租用、服務(wù)器托管、云服務(wù)器、虛擬主機、網(wǎng)站系統(tǒng)開發(fā)經(jīng)驗。專業(yè)提供云主機、虛擬主機、域名注冊、VPS主機、云服務(wù)器、香港云服務(wù)器、免備案服務(wù)器等。